Nebius (NASDAQ: NBIS), the AI cloud company, and Bloom Energy today announced an agreement to deploy Bloom’s fuel cell technology to help power Nebius’s AI infrastructure build-out. Nebius selected Bloom for its fast time to power, clean, virtually non-polluting technology, and its ability to support the extreme performance demands of AI workloads.

...

Bloom fuel cells generate electricity without combustion, making them highly efficient with low emissions and minimal water use, supporting Nebius’s strategy to scale AI infrastructure with a lower environmental footprint. Fuel-cell systems typically face a lighter permitting burden than combustion-based generation, further accelerating the timeline from site selection to operational capacity.
